Congressman James E. Clyburn (D-SC) statement on recent Trump administration appointment of Steve Bannon and nomination of Jeff Sessions


F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E: November 18, 2016
CONTACT: Patrick Devlin, 202-226-3210

WASHINGTON, D.C. – Assistant Democratic Leader James E. Clyburn (D-SC) released the following statement today:

“Donald Trump’s recent staffing and nomination announcements are a sad but predictable continuation of his spiteful, divisive campaign,” said Assistant Democratic Leader James E. Clyburn. “Steve Bannon has taken pride in giving voice and an online home to radical white-supremacist groups. There should be no place in the White House for his brand of misogynistic, bigoted, anti-Semitic and xenophobic normalcy.

“Senator Sessions has faced serious allegations throughout his career and was rightly rejected for a federal judgeship because of them. His civil rights record is appalling and should disqualify him from Senate confirmation.

“Together the Bannon appointment and nomination of Senator Sessions for Attorney General represent a frightening return to a dark and dangerous past for minority communities in Donald Trump’s America. They threaten the civil rights progress we’ve made and are significant roadblocks to healing the racial divisions laid bare by the recent election. I firmly oppose both and urge Donald Trump to rescind the appointment of Steve Bannon as Chief Strategist and the nomination of Senator Sessions for Attorney General.
